About Amit Kaura

Amit Kaura is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Epidemiology and Infectious Diseases, having authored 32 papers that have together received 349 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(7 papers),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(7 papers),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(5 papers),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(3 papers),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(3 papers),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(3 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(2 papers) and Infective Endocarditis Diagnosis and Management (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(182 citations), Health Informatics (6 citations), Health (33 citations), Modeling and Simulation (18 citations) and Infectious Diseases (69 citations). Amit Kaura has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Saudi Arabia. Frequent co-authors include Paul A. Scott, Nicholas Sunderland, Max Baghai, Olaf Wendler, Umberto Benedetto, James Teo, Rafał Dworakowski, Anthony Li, Paramdeep S. Dhillon and Abdulrahim Mulla. Their work appears in journals such as European Heart Journal, Heart, Journal of the American College of Cardiology, Open Heart and Journal of Interventional Cardiac Electrophysiology.
